Easy Baklava Cups: A Sweetbite Treat for Quick Dessert Lovers

Easy Baklava Cups are buttery, layered pastries made with phyllo, honey, and nuts, baked in individual cups for a 30-minute dessert. This version uses minimal effort for maximum flavor, with crispy layers and a drizzle of spiced syrup. Here you will find the exact ingredients, detailed steps, and mistakes to avoid.

Prep Time 15 mins
Cook Time 10 mins
Total Time 25 mins
Servings 8-10 cups
Difficulty Easy
Category Dessert
Cuisine Mediterranean

Ingrédients

Ingrédient Quantité Notes
Phyllo Sheets 1 package (17.3 oz) Thaw overnight; use gluten-free if needed
Unsalted Butter 1/2 cup, melted Room temperature for even melting
Chopped Pecans/Walnuts 1 1/2 cups Use mixed nuts or pistachios
Honey 1/2 cup Add maple syrup as substitute
Granulated Sugar 1/4 cup Adjust to taste
Cinnamon 1 tsp Plus extra for garnish
Vanilla Extract 1 tbsp Use almond extract for a twist

Step by Step Instructions

    Preparation

  1. Preheat oven to 325°F (160°C). Lightly grease mini cupcake liners or muffin tins.
  2. Beat melted butter with a fork to reduce lumps. Set aside.
  3. In a bowl, combine chopped nuts, 1 tbsp cinnamon, and 2 tbsp of the honey. Mix until uniformly coated.
  4. Layering

  5. Carefully unroll phyllo sheet; cover with a damp towel to prevent drying.
  6. Cut into 3″ x 3″ squares using a ruler and knife.
  7. Stack 3 phyllo squares in each liner, brushing melted butter between layers.
  8. Sprinkle 1 tbsp nut mixture over phyllo in each cup.
  9. Add another 2 phyllo layers with butter, then top with remaining nut mixture and final phyllo layer.

    Finishing

  10. Bake 8-10 minutes until edges are golden yellow.
  11. In a small saucepan, warm remaining honey with sugar, cinnamon, and vanilla. Boil 2-3 minutes.
  12. Remove cups from oven and spoon 1-2 tbsp syrup over each. Let cool 5 minutes before serving.

Chef’s Tips for Perfect Results

  • Use a pastry brush for even butter application—it saves time and creates more consistent layers.
  • Don’t overlayer phyllo: 3-4 layers per cup achieves the perfect balance of crisp and nutty content.
  • Wait 15 minutes before serving to let syrup soak in fully. Served at room temperature, the layers maintain their crispness
  • For mini cupcake tins, use silicone molds that release easily without sticking.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overcooking phyllo: Watch for golden edges—burned phyllo becomes brittle instead of flaky. Adjust oven rack to middle position.
  • Under-syruping: The syrup adds moisture; skip it and the phyllo will become dry. Use 1-2 tbsp per cup depending on size.
  • Using cold phyllo: Always work with room-temperature phyllo to avoid tearing. Keep leftover sheets covered until ready to use.
  • Overfilling cups: Leave 1/4″ headspace to allow syrup to spread evenly without spillage.

Variants and Substitutions

Ingredient Substitution Impact on Taste
Phyllo Sheets Puff pastry sheets, cut into squares Less delicate but still crunchy and buttery
Honey Agave nectar Thinner syrup with slightly neutral flavor
Pecans/Walnuts Chopped pistachios or almonds More color and milder nuttiness
Butter Olive oil (3/4 cup + 2 tbsp) Earthy undertones, popular in Greek recipes

Storage and Reheating

Method Duration Instructions
Refrigerator 2-3 days Store in airtight container between parchment layers
Freezer 1 month Wrap individually in plastic wrap then store in freezer-safe bag
Room Temperature 4-6 hours (cooler days only) Keep in covered container to retain crispness

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use puff pastry instead of phyllo?

Yes – cut puff pastry into squares and follow the same layering method. The result will be denser but still delicious with a similar buttery texture and honey glaze.

How do I tell when the baklava cups are done?

The phyllo layers will turn deep golden yellow and crisp within 8-10 minutes. Avoid overbrowning – remove from oven immediately when edges begin to darken.

Why are my layers soggy after adding syrup?

Cold phyllo absorbs moisture from the syrup before it’s fully baked. Always add syrup to warm cups while they’re still in the oven to preserve crispness.

Can I make these ahead of time?

Prepare layered cups 2 days in advance and refrigerate. Add syrup 1 hour before serving to maintain freshness. Freeze unbaked layers for up to 2 weeks.

What’s the best way to customize these cups?

Experiment with fillings like dried fruit, crumbled goat cheese, or dark chocolate shavings. Try spicing variations with cardamom, orange zest, or rosewater in the syrup.
